Job Overview
We are delighted to welcome applications from outstanding, dynamic and suitably experienced individuals for the role of Piano Teacher to be in post ready for the school opening in September 2025.
This is a superb opportunity for the right candidate to leverage their experience as a music specialist in a high-performing school environment to help establish world-class Music provision at Wetherby Pembridge. Working closely with the Founding Head of Music, the successful candidate will have an exciting role in helping to develop an innovative, ambitious and comprehensive Music programme for this exciting new chapter in the Wetherby Pembridge journey.
Key Responsibilities
- To teach the highest quality individual music lessons to pupils
- To promote musical excellence and enjoyment of music by demonstrating instrumental skills to pupils.
- To ensure the safeguarding of all pupils, in line with the school’s safeguarding policy.
- To ensure progress of all pupils by preparing and teaching lessons appropriately tailored for each student.
- To have a clear knowledge and understanding of the requirements and marking criteria for music exams relevant to your instrument(s).
- Use departmental systems of awards and monitoring concerns in order to communicate pupil’s progress and/or concerns with the Head of Music in a timely manner.
- Where applicable, to communicate with parents pupil’s progress and/or concerns.
- To direct ensembles and/or music activities when timetables allow and as per the request of the Head of Music.
The Ideal Candidate Will
- Have a bachelor\’s degree in Music.
- Proven success in teaching instrumental lessons to various ages and skill levels.
- Professional performance experience.
- Professional standard in playing main instrument.
- Excellent interpersonal skills and ability to communicate effectively with students, parents, and colleagues.
- Strong organisational abilities to manage schedules, lesson plans, and student progress effectively.
- Capability to adapt teaching methods to meet the individual needs and learning styles of students.
- Commitment to maintaining high standards of professionalism and ethics in all interactions.
- Flexibility in scheduling lessons to accommodate the availability of students and school timetables.
- Genuine passion for music education and a desire to inspire a love of music in students.

How to prepare for a job interview at TES FE News
✨Showcase Your Musical Passion
During the interview, express your genuine love for music and teaching. Share personal anecdotes about how music has impacted your life and how you aim to inspire that same passion in your students.
✨Demonstrate Teaching Flexibility
Be prepared to discuss how you adapt your teaching methods to cater to different learning styles. Provide examples of how you've successfully tailored lessons for various age groups and skill levels.
✨Highlight Your Performance Experience
Since professional performance experience is a key requirement, be ready to talk about your own performances. Discuss how this experience informs your teaching and helps you connect with students.
✨Prepare for Safeguarding Questions
Understand the importance of safeguarding in an educational environment. Be ready to discuss how you would ensure the safety and well-being of your students while promoting a positive learning atmosphere.
